Choosing the Perfect Location
When it concerns owning a rental property in Greece, choosing the right area is crucial. Each Greek island has its own special personality and brings in various sorts of vacationers. Take into consideration the list below factors when choosing your suitable area:
Target Audience
Identify your target market and their choices. Are you targeting family members looking for a calm escape or young vacationers looking for lively nightlife? Investigating the demographics and preferences of prospective tenants will certainly help you determine the most effective island for your rental property.
Accessibility
Consider exactly how easily accessible the island is for both global and domestic vacationers. Islands with well-connected airport terminals or ferry ports often tend to draw in even more tourists throughout the year.
Amenities and Infrastructure
Ensure that the island has appropriate features and infrastructure to sustain tourism tasks. This includes restaurants, stores, medical facilities, transportation options, and trusted net connectivity.
Seasonality
Take right into account the seasonality of each island. Some islands are busy during the summer season yet end up being peaceful throughout the off-season. If you intend to generate year-round revenue from your rental home, choose an island that brings in visitors throughout the year.
Finding Your Desire Property
Once you have picked your liked area, it's time to locate your dream residential property in Greece. Below are some steps to lead you via the procedure:
Determine Your Budget
Set a realistic budget for your investment. Consider not just the purchase price however additionally extra expenses such as taxes, legal charges, restoration costs (if any kind of), and ongoing maintenance.
Engage a Local Property Agent
Working with a credible local property agent can conserve you effort and time in locating appropriate buildings that meet your standards. They have useful understanding regarding the marketplace patterns, legal requirements, and can assist you through the settlement and purchase process.
Property Inspections
Before wrapping up the purchase, conduct thorough inspections of the property to determine any type of possible issues. This consists of monitoring for architectural stability, pipes, electric systems, and compliance with structure regulations.
Legal Considerations
Ensure that all lawful aspects remain in order prior to completing the purchase. This consists of validating home ownership, getting required authorizations and licenses for vacation services (if applicable), and comprehending regional residential property laws and regulations.
Managing Your Rental Property
Congratulations on ending up being a pleased owner of a Greek rental residential or commercial property! Currently comes the interesting part-- managing your financial investment and maximizing its possibility. Below are some tips on exactly how to efficiently handle your rental home:
Professional Building Administration Services
Consider working with professional residential or commercial property administration services to handle the daily procedures of your rental residential property. They can take care of tasks such as advertising, guest questions, bookings, check-ins/check-outs, cleansing solutions, and maintenance. This permits you to concentrate on other elements of your financial investment or merely take pleasure in island life hassle-free.
Create an Engaging Listing
To draw in prospective occupants, develop an engaging listing that showcases the distinct functions and charm of your home. Usage high-grade photographs, emphasize essential amenities, and supply comprehensive summaries to entice vacationers to pick your rental over others.
Set Competitive Pricing
Research similar rental residential properties in your location to determine competitive pricing. Setting the right cost is vital for drawing in bookings while making certain a healthy return on investment. Think about seasonal fluctuations popular and adjust your prices accordingly.
Market Your Building Effectively
Utilize various advertising and marketing networks to reach a larger target market. Note your residential property on prominent holiday rental websites, promote it with social networks platforms, work together with local tour drivers or travel agencies, and urge pleased guests to leave evaluations or referrals.

Q: Can immigrants own building in Greece? A: Yes, immigrants can possess residential property in Greece. There are no constraints on home ownership for EU residents. Non-EU people may need to get permission from the Greek authorities, yet it is typically a straightforward process.
Q: Do I need an authorization to rent my property in Greece? A: Yes, if you prepare to rent out your residential property as a trip rental, you will certainly need to acquire a permit from the Greek National Tourist Organization (GNTO). This ensures that your home satisfies specific safety and top quality standards.
